Transaction 2459688c6350ed8a8e470fd90376ac18fc006e095894513f1379b5db83224c6d
1 Input
1 Output
-
2459688c6350ed8a8e470fd90376ac18fc006e095894513f1379b5db83224c6d:0
- value
- 6573737
- script pubkey
- OP_0 OP_PUSHBYTES_20 d561835bca37dfb089c17235be86a44a4f3fa8f1
- address
- bc1q64scxk72xl0mpzwpwg6map4yff8nl283wm95v9